Roof water leak detection services involve thorough inspections to identify the source of leaks that may be causing water intrusion into a property. Skilled service providers use specialized tools and techniques to examine roofing materials, attic spaces, and gutters to locate the exact point where water is penetrating. This process often includes visual assessments, moisture measurements, and sometimes the use of infrared imaging to detect hidden leaks that are not immediately visible. Accurate detection is essential to prevent further damage and to determine the most effective repair approach.
These services help address a variety of problems caused by roof leaks, such as water stains on ceilings, m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age. Undetected leaks can lead to costly repairs if left unaddressed, and they may also compromise the integrity of the roof over time. Detecting leaks early can save homeowners money by allowing repairs to be made before more extensive damage occurs. Additionally, identifying leaks can improve indoor air quality and prevent issues like musty odors caused by excess moisture.

The overview below groups typical Roof Water Leak Detection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Glen Carbon,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Many routine water leak detection jobs in Glen Carbon and nearby areas typically cost between $250 and $600. These projects often involve locating leaks in accessible roof areas or minor pipe issues. Most common repairs fall within this range, reflecting standard service calls.
Moderate Projects - Larger or more complex leak detection efforts, such as inspecting multiple roof sections or hidden pipe systems, can range from $600 to $1,500. These projects are less frequent but are common for ongoing maintenance or persistent leak problems.
Extensive Leak Detection - When leaks are difficult to locate or involve extensive roof or plumbing systems, costs can range from $1,500 to $3,000. Many of these jobs are specialized and require advanced techniques, with fewer projects reaching the top of this range.
Full Roof or System Replacement - In cases where leaks are caused by significant damage or failure, full roof or plumbing system replacements may cost $5,000 or more. These larger projects are less common but necessary for severe issues requiring comprehensive work by local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How can I tell if my roof has a leak? Signs of a roof leak include water stains on ceilings or walls, mold growth, or missing shingles. If you notice any of these, a local contractor can help assess the situation.
What causes roof water leaks? Common causes include damaged or missing shingles, flashing issues, clogged gutters, or aging roofing materials. A professional inspection can identify the specific cause.
Are roof water leaks difficult to detect? Some leaks are visible, but others may be hidden behind walls or ceilings. Local service providers use specialized techniques to locate hard-to-find leaks.
Can roof water leaks lead to other problems? Yes, leaks can cause structural damage, mold growth, and interior water damage if not addressed promptly. Connecting with a local contractor can help prevent further issues.
What methods do service providers use to detect roof water leaks? They often use visual inspections, moisture meters, and sometimes infrared imaging to accurately locate leaks without unnecessary damage.
